Processing

Once collected, the samples are immediately processed. The stem cells are separated from the cord blood. This can then be stored and used for clinical procedures. The United States Food and Drug Administration (USFDA) says that the cord blood unit should ideally be reduced so that it has a low plasma and red blood cell count before being cryopreserved. A few centers for stem cell banking in Mumbai and other cities in India work with this standard. This reduces the chances of future complications.

Storage of Cells and Tissue

After processing, the unit is ready for cryopreservation. Irrespective of the manner in which the sample unit has been processed, a cryopreservant is added to it, to ensure that the cells are able to survive through the cryogenic process. The stems cells are cooled slowly until they reach a temperature of −90°C, after which they are transferred to a tank filled with liquid nitrogen. They are kept frozen at −196°C, until future use. Stem cell banking in Mumbai and other cities in India also follow this slow cooling process, which ensures that the samples are not compromised in any way.

Reasons Why Stem Cell Banking Is Needed

Cord blood is actually a sample of the blood taken from the umbilical cord of a new born baby. This blood is considered to be aninstantly available rich source of stem cells,which helps in fighting over 80 diseases, some of which are life threatening also like cancer. The cord blood is collected immediately after the birth of the baby. It is a completely straightforward procedure with no involvement of either the mother or the child. The needle for collection of cord blood is inserted in that part of the umbilical vein which is still connected to the placenta and then the cord blood is extracted for approximately 10 minutes.

This needle does not go anywhere near the baby. The blood once collected is then immediately rushed to the cord blood stem cell bank. Cord blood banking actually means extracting and preserving the blood collected from the baby’s umbilical cord immediately after the birth. If there is a delay then the blood starts clotting become useless.

The cord blood thus collected can either be preserved for future use in the family cord blood stem cell bank or can be donated for public use. Either way it is a great tool for future and can be used for treatment of several fatal diseases like leukemia, blood disorders and lymphoma. Preserving the sample is of a great use as it can not only be utilised by the donor, but in some cases by the siblings too. Research has shown that use of cord blood is very effective for the siblings rather than unrelated recipients. Also complications are fewer in related recipients than in the unrelated ones.

Generally, there are two types of banks which store the cord blood, public as well as private. The cord blood donated to the public banks is utilised for the general public and the one stored in the private banks is utilised for only the family members of the donor.
